Follow these easy steps for a foolproof meal that\u2019ll have everyone asking for seconds.<\/p>\n<h3>Step 1: Prep the Ingredients<\/h3>\n<p>First, chop those veggies! I like chunky carrot coins (about \u00bd-inch thick) so they don\u2019t turn to mush. Dice the onion, slice the celery (don\u2019t forget those flavorful leaves!), and cube the potatoes into bite-sized pieces. No need to be perfect\u2014rustic cuts give this stew its homey charm. For the chicken, I simply pat the thighs dry and give them a generous sprinkle of salt and pepper right in the slow cooker.<\/p>\n<h3>Step 2: Slow Cook the Stew<\/h3>\n<p>Dump everything in! Layer the veggies over the chicken, then pour in the broth and sprinkle the herbs. That bay leaf? Just toss it right on top\u2014it\u2019ll work its magic as it sinks down. Now set it and forget it: 6-7 hours on LOW for fall-apart tender chicken, or 3-4 hours on HIGH if you\u2019re in a hurry. (Though I always choose LOW\u2014the extra time makes the broth taste incredible.)<\/p>\n<h3>Step 3: Thicken the Stew (Optional)<\/h3>\n<p>Love a hearty, spoon-coating broth like I do? About 30 minutes before serving, mix cornstarch with cold water until smooth, then stir it into the bubbling stew. Leave the lid off to let it thicken up\u2014you\u2019ll see the transformation! No cornstarch? Just mash some potatoes against the pot\u2019s side to naturally thicken the broth.<\/p>\n<p><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/recipesuniverse.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/11\/Slow-Cooker-Chicken-Stew-Recipe-1.jpg\" alt=\"Slow Cooker Chicken Stew Recipe - detail 2\" data-jpibfi-post-excerpt=\"\" data-jpibfi-post-url=\"https:\/\/recipesuniverse.com\/slow-cooker-chicken-stew-recipe\/\" data-jpibfi-post-title=\"Slow Cooker Chicken Stew\" data-jpibfi-src=\"https:\/\/recipesuniverse.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/11\/Slow-Cooker-Chicken-Stew-Recipe-1.jpg\" data-jpibfi-indexer=\"2\" \/><\/p>\n<h2>Tips for the Best Slow Cooker Chicken Stew Recipe<\/h2>\n<p>Want to take your stew from good to <em>wow<\/em>? Store cooled leftovers in an airtight container\u2014they\u2019ll keep in the fridge for 3-4 days. Freeze portions for up to 3 months (just leave a little space for expansion). To reheat, warm gently on the stove with a splash of broth to loosen it up, or microwave in 30-second bursts, stirring between each. Pro tip: Fish out the bay leaf before storing\u2014nobody wants a surprise leaf in their lunch!<\/p>\n<h2>Nutritional Information<\/h2>\n<p>Now, I\u2019m no nutritionist, but I do love knowing what\u2019s going into my family\u2019s meals! And since it\u2019s broth-based, it keeps you full without heavy cream or loads of butter (though no judgment if you add that pat of butter at the end like I do!).<\/p>\n<h2>FAQ About Slow Cooker Chicken Stew Recipe<\/h2>\n<p>Over the years, I\u2019ve gotten so many questions about this stew\u2014here are the ones that pop up most often in my kitchen (and my inbox)!<\/p>\n<p><strong>Can I use chicken breasts instead of thighs?<\/strong><br \/>\nYou <em>can<\/em>, but I don\u2019t recommend it\u2014thighs stay juicy during long cooking, while breasts tend to dry out. If you must use breasts, reduce cooking time by 1 hour and check early. But seriously, try thighs just once\u2014you\u2019ll never go back!<\/p>\n<p><strong>How do I make this gluten-free?<\/strong><br \/>\nEasy! Just ensure your broth is gluten-free (many brands are) and skip the cornstarch or use arrowroot powder instead. All the other ingredients\u2014chicken, veggies, herbs\u2014are naturally gluten-free. I\u2019ve served this to gluten-sensitive friends many times with zero issues.<\/p>\n<p><strong>My stew turned out too watery\u2014help!<\/strong><br \/>\nNo worries! Either simmer uncovered for 15-20 minutes to reduce, or mix 1 tbsp cornstarch with 2 tbsp cold water and stir it in. Another trick? Mash some potatoes against the pot\u2019s side\u2014they\u2019ll thicken the broth naturally while adding creaminess.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Can I freeze leftovers?<\/strong><br \/>\nAbsolutely! This stew freezes like a dream. Just cool completely, then portion into freezer bags (I lay them flat to save space). Thaw overnight in the fridge, then reheat gently on the stove with a splash of broth to refresh the flavors.<\/p>\n<p><strong>What if I don\u2019t have fresh herbs?<\/strong><br \/>\nDried work great here\u2014in fact, I often use them for convenience! The general rule: 1 tsp dried = 1 tbsp fresh. Rub dried herbs between your palms before adding to wake up their oils. No rosemary? Try a pinch of oregano or marjoram instead.<\/p>\n<h2>Share Your Feedback<\/h2>\n<p>Nothing makes me happier than hearing how this stew turned out in your kitchen!
